A YouTuber, who has visited every country globally, has ranked his favourite countries in Asia, with the Philippines taking the top spot due to its stunning beaches and welcoming locals.

Drew Binsky, a popular travel vlogger, expressed his love for the Philippines in a recent YouTube video, saying: "I've spent the last 12 years visiting every single country in the world.

"Asia is my favourite continent, the place I've called home for eight years and it's where I'm travelling right now. I spent two years of my life travelling in the Philippines. It's a land of over 7,500 islands and people are so friendly.

"The food is one of the most underrated in the world. And honestly, if you want the best beaches, look no further than the Philippines.

"My favourite places are Siquijor, Bohol, Palawan, Siargao and Romblon. I hope you can make it to the Philippines."

Drew's affection for the Philippines may be influenced by his personal connection to the country, as his wife, Deanna Sallao, is Filipino, and they got married there last year, reports the Express.

In contrast, Brunei and Bahrain ranked at the bottom of his list. The intrepid traveller Drew talked down Brunei, saying: "It was cool the second time around but it still wasn't that awesome. It's just boring. There are strict curfews there and laws, you just get this feeling that everyone is watching over your shoulder."

He described feeling underwhelmed by its attractions, except for the unique stilt homes.

Reflecting on Bahrain, Drew remarked: "The coolest thing about Bahrain is the F1 race which I haven't been to. Other than that I just find it to be not exciting. It's a dry country."

Although illegal above ground, he confessed to indulging in the underground party scene: "Underground you can go partying and drink which is what I did when I was there. I didn't connect with the culture that much.

"I'd much rather go to more exciting cities, I'd rather go to Dubai, even Jeddah was more exciting for me."

image

Drew's blunt video drew criticism, particularly from viewers familiar with Bahrain, challenging his impressions: "The things you told about Bahrain are straight up wrong."

They defended the nation, pointing out that Bahrain is comparatively liberal with a rich history, highlighting its many castles, historical Tree of Life, and welcoming mosques.

Addressing the back-and-forth in his comment section, Drew responded to allegations of bias towards his top pick, the Philippines, due to personal ties. Contesting such claims, he clarified: "It was number one years before I met Deanna. The Philippines is simply the best!"
